Vasili Sergeyevich Cherov (Russian: Василий Сергеевич Черов; born 13 January 1996) is a Russian football player who plays for FC Krasnodar-2.

He made his professional debut in the Russian Professional Football League for FC Krasnodar-2 on 15 April 2014 in a game against FC Vityaz Krymsk.[1]

International

He represented Russia national under-19 football team at the 2015 UEFA European Under-19 Championship, where Russia came in second place.
